We use data collection devices such as “cookies” on certain pages of the Website to help analyse our web page flow, measure promotional effectiveness, and promote trust and safety. “Cookies” are small files placed on your hard drive that assist us in providing our services. We offer certain features that are only available through the use of a “cookie”. We also use cookies to allow you to enter your password less frequently during a session.

Cookies can also help us provide information that is targeted to your interests. Most cookies are “session cookies”, meaning that they are automatically deleted from your hard drive at the end of a session. By accepting this Privacy Policy, you confirm your consent to Accuverse’s use of cookies and other such technologies. You are always free to decline our cookies if your browser permits, although in that case you may not be able to use certain features on the Website and you may be required to re-enter your password more frequently during a session. The E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) provides EU residents with the below rights: (i) Right to information – including contact details of the controller and the purposes for processing Personal Information; (ii) Right to erase the Personal Information (“Right to be forgotten”); (iii) Right to rectify the Personal Information; (iv) Right to restrict the processing of the Personal Information; (v) Right to data portability of the Personal Information supplied to Accuverse by the EU resident; and (vi) Right to opt-out to processing.
